What is the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
The Income and Expense Appeal Form allows property owners to challenge their property tax assessments effectively. This form serves as a crucial tool in ensuring fair taxation based on accurate property evaluations. To successfully appeal, the form must include notarized signatures and be submitted by the specified deadlines, often essential for the assessment process. It directly connects to the income and expense form, which provides the necessary financial data for the appeal.
Why Use the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
Filing an appeal using the Income and Expense Appeal Form offers numerous benefits, including potential reductions in property tax. Property owners may find this form critical when facing incomplete assessments or significant discrepancies during the valuation of their properties. To maximize the chances of a successful appeal, it is vital to adhere to the submission deadlines, as late submissions can hinder the appeal process.

Who Needs the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
The Income and Expense Appeal Form is primarily aimed at property owners who may need to contest their tax assessments. This group includes owners of both commercial and residential properties. Specific situations, such as inaccuracies in the property assessment or changes in income levels affecting taxation, may necessitate the use of this form.

What are the eligibility requirements for submitting the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
Property owners must have a valid reason to appeal their property tax assessments, which should include a detailed explanation of income and expenses. It's essential to have all necessary supporting documents ready for submission.
What is the deadline for submitting the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
The completed Income and Expense Appeal Form must be received by the assessor's office by September 30, 2014. It is crucial to adhere to this deadline to ensure your appeal is considered.
What methods are available for submitting the form?
The Income and Expense Appeal Form can typically be submitted by mailing it to the assessor's office or, in some cases, electronically through a website like pdfFiller, depending on local regulations.
What supporting documents are required when submitting the form?
You should include detailed explanations of your income and expenses, along with any other documentation that might help substantiate your appeal, such as recent tax statements and financial records.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out this form?
Ensure all fields are correctly filled out, particularly the signature and notarization sections. Double-check for any missed entries and confirm that all required documents are attached before submission.
How long does it take to process the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
Processing times can vary by jurisdiction; however, you should expect to hear back regarding your appeal within several weeks to a few months after submission, depending on the workload of the assessor's office.
Are there any fees associated with submitting the Income and Expense Appeal Form?
Typically, there are no fees for submitting an appeal form; however, it’s wise to check local regulations for any specific requirements or potential costs involved in the appeal process.
